China Railways SS8
The Shaoshan 8 (SS8; Chinese: 韶山8) is a semi-high-speed electric locomotive used on the People's Republic of China's national railway system. The SS8 is based on its predecessor, the SS5, and was developed and built by CSR Zhuzhou Electric Locomotive Works. Production A total of 245 (0001–0243, 2001–2002) SS8s have been built since 1994. Batch production commenced in 1997. Routes The only route they were used on was the Jingguang line, the railway line linking Beijing West railway station with Guangzhou, Guangdong. The SS8 currently serves the Shanghai–Kowloon through train and the Beijing–Kowloon through train. Speed record On June 24, 1998, the SS8 broke the Chinese rail speed record by achieving a top speed of on a test run between Xuchang and Xiaoshangqiao. The locomotive used was fleet number 0001. CRRC Zhuzhou Locomotive
CRRC Zhuzhou Locomotive Co., Ltd. is one of the electric locomotive manufacturers in China. It is one of the subsidiaries of CRRC. History Predecessor Zhuzhou Electric Locomotive Works was founded in 1936. CRRC Zhuzhou Locomotive Co., Ltd. On 31 August 2005, CSR Group Zhuzhou Electric Locomotive Co., Ltd. was spin-off from the locomotive works; the original legal entity of the locomotive works became an intermediate holding company for CSR Group only. After the formation of listed company CSR Corporation Limited, the limited company "CSR Group Zhuzhou Electric Locomotive" became part of the listed portion of the group, and the intermediate holding company remained unlisted. The limited company also renamed to CSR Zhuzhou Electric Locomotive Co., Ltd., In 2015 the company was renamed into CRRC Zhuzhou Locomotive Co., Ltd. (). Beijing–Kowloon Through Train
The Beijing–Kowloon through train () is an intercity railway service between Hung Hom station (formerly Kowloon station until 1998) in Hong Kong and the Beijing West railway station, jointly operated by the MTRC of Hong Kong and China Railway, China's national rail service. The train runs to Beijing and Hong Kong every other day. Services use the East Rail line in Hong Kong, cross the boundary between Hong Kong and mainland China at Lo Wu and then continue along China's railway network via the Guangshen railway and the Jingguang railway to Beijing. Total journey time is approximately 23 hours, and the train uses 25T class train carriages. From 28 December 2017, travellers of selected nationalities are able to utilise the 144-hour transit when travelling on this line to or from Beijing, providing that they clear immigration in Beijing. Bo-Bo Locomotives
B-B and Bo-Bo are the Association of American Railroads (AAR) and British classifications of wheel arrangement for railway locomotives with four axles in two individual bogies. They are equivalent to the B′B′ and Bo′Bo′ classifications in the UIC system. The arrangement of two, two-axled, bogies is a common wheel arrangement for modern electric and diesel locomotives. Bo-Bo Bo-Bo is the UIC indication of a wheel arrangement for railway vehicles with four axles in two individual bogies, all driven by their own traction motors. It is a common wheel arrangement for modern electric and diesel-electric locomotives, as well as power cars in electric multiple units. Most early electric locomotives shared commonalities with the steam engines of their time. These features included side rods and frame mounted driving axles with leading and trailing axles. Diesel Locomotive
A diesel locomotive is a type of railway locomotive in which the prime mover is a diesel engine. Several types of diesel locomotives have been developed, differing mainly in the means by which mechanical power is conveyed to the driving wheels. Early internal combustion locomotives and railcars used kerosene and gasoline as their fuel. Rudolf Diesel patented his first compression-ignition engine in 1898, and steady improvements to the design of diesel engines reduced their physical size and improved their power-to-weight ratios to a point where one could be mounted in a locomotive. Internal combustion engines only operate efficiently within a limited power band, and while low power gasoline engines could be coupled to mechanical transmissions, the more powerful diesel engines required the development of new forms of transmission. China Railways DF11
The Dongfeng -11 diesel locomotives (DF11)(Chinese:东风11), is a semi-high-speed diesel locomotive, from China Qishuyan Locomotive Works Manufacturing Co. used by the China Railway. Overview China Railways DF11 Diesel-electric locomotive is a semi-high-speed passenger locomotive. It was an important scientific and technological objective of China's Eighth Five-Year Plan, and was designed for runs on the Guangzhou-Shenzhen Railway. The Guangzhou-Shenzhen Railway line will open with an operating speed of , utilizing high-speed passenger trains and the level of potential development of a new type of high speed passenger diesel locomotive. By the end of 1990 development was begun by the Qishuyan Locomotive Works, who modified a DF9 locomotive, changing traction motor gear transmission ratio, thereby increasing the maximum speed from up to . Pantograph (rail)
A pantograph (or "pan" or "panto") is an apparatus mounted on the roof of an electric train, tram or electric bus to collect power through contact with an overhead line. By contrast, battery electric buses and trains are charged at charging stations. The pantograph is a common type of current collector; typically, a single or double wire is used, with the return current running through the rails. The term stems from the resemblance of some styles to the mechanical pantographs used for copying handwriting and drawings. Invention The pantograph, with a low-friction, replaceable graphite contact strip or "shoe" to minimise lateral stress on the contact wire, first appeared in the late 19th century. Locomotive
A locomotive or engine is a rail transport vehicle that provides the Power (physics), motive power for a train. If a locomotive is capable of carrying a payload, it is usually rather referred to as a multiple unit, Motor coach (rail), motor coach, railcar or power car; the use of these self-propelled vehicles is increasingly common for passenger trains, but rare for freight (see CargoSprinter). Traditionally, locomotives pulled trains from the front. However, Push-pull train, push-pull operation has become common, where the train may have a locomotive (or locomotives) at the front, at the rear, or at each end. Most recently railroads have begun adopting DPU or distributed power. East Rail Line
The East Rail line () is one of ten lines of the Mass Transit Railway (MTR) system in Hong Kong. It used to be one of the three lines of the Kowloon–Canton Railway (KCR) network. It was known as the KCR British Section () from 1910 to 1996, and the KCR East Rail () from 1996 to 2007. East Rail was the only railway line of the Kowloon-Canton Railway Corporation (KCRC) following the closure of the Sha Tau Kok Railway and before the construction of ''KCR West Rail'' (later renamed West Rail line, now part of the Tuen Ma line). The railway line starts at Admiralty on Hong Kong Island and branches in the north at Sheung Shui to terminate at Lo Wu or Lok Ma Chau stations. Both are border crossing points into Shenzhen. All of the stations on the line except Admiralty, Exhibition Centre and Hung Hom are at-grade or elevated. The distance between Hung Hom and Lo Wu stations is . Kowloon–Canton Railway
The Kowloon–Canton Railway (KCR; ) was a railway network in Hong Kong.Legislative Council information paper CB(1)357/07-08(0 THB(T) CR 8/986/00, CB(1)1749/07-08(0/ref> It was owned and operated by the Kowloon-Canton Railway Corporation (KCRC) until 2007. Rapid transit services, a light rail system, feeder bus routes within Hong Kong, and intercity passenger and freight train services to China on the KCR network, have been operated by the MTR Corporation since 2007. While still owned by its previous operator, the KCR network (which is wholly owned by the Hong Kong Government through the KCRC) has been operated by the MTR Corporation Limited under a 50-year, extendible, service concession since 2 December 2007. The two companies have merged their local metro lines into one unified fare system.
